Hey everyone. I have a m710q Lenovo (Tiny form factor, ) that I'm trying to get Opencore 0.7.7 and Monterey 12.2 onto. This is is my first time running Opencore, but I have quite a bit of experience with Clover on 3rd and 4th gen Intel/Gigabyte combos. I've managed to get the computer to install the OS and it boots and runs great. My last remaining problem is sleep. I have tried everything I can think of to get the machine to sleep properly, but it will not wake at all. I've mapped the USB ports using Hackintool already, and power management seems to be working, but I'm still not having any luck. Are there any experts here who can review my config and suggest some changes?
SMBIOS: iMac18,1
Brand: Lenovo
Product: m710q (Tiny)
CPU: i5-7500T (Kaby Lake)
RAM: 16Gb
BT/Wifi: BCM9430CS2 (Apple chip installed in adapter board to M.2 slot)
Drive 1: 512Gb Samsung NVMe (Windows)
Drive 2: 256Gb Crucial SATA SSD (Monterey)
